View the instance. A fast glance at Mitchell’s text demonstrates three sections. Two of these have headings: “Segregated Coexistence” and “Residing in Local community.” Another portion seems firstly of the short article, so you can think of this just one as “Introduction.
Focusing on a duplicate of one section from the post that you will be working on, eliminate the examples. Utilizing a black pen or highlighter, cross out or go over in excess of all the things that's an instance, whether or not it’s an entire paragraph, a sentence, or Element of a sentence. Read what’s left, and produce a quick description of the primary point of that area.

If you string subject matter sentences alongside one another, you can get the gist of your author’s point in a very textual content. You can spotlight These sentences in your text, however it may also enable to copy those sentences into a different document and read them alongside one another.
